Sump pump plumbing services involve installing, repairing, or replacing sump pumps that help keep basements and crawl spaces dry. A sump pump is a device installed in a pit, typically located in the lowest part of a property’s foundation, that automatically activates when water accumulates. These systems work to remove excess groundwater or rainwater that seeps into the property, preventing flooding and water damage. Local service providers can evaluate the specific needs of a property, recommend the appropriate sump pump type, and ensure proper installation for reliable operation.
Problems that sump pump services help solve often stem from heavy rainfall, poor drainage, or high water tables, which can lead to basement flooding and water intrusion. Common issues include a sump pump that fails to turn on during storms, runs continuously due to a stuck float switch, or becomes clogged with debris. Additionally, older or improperly installed pumps may not function effectively when needed most. Professional sump pump services can diagnose these issues, perform necessary repairs, or suggest upgrades to improve the system’s performance and prevent costly water damage.

The overview below groups typical Sump Pump Plumbing proj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in South Zanesville, OH.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for routine sump pump repairs, such as replacing a float switch or fixing a minor leak, usually range from $150 to $400. Many common repairs fall within this middle range, with fewer jobs reaching the higher end of the spectrum.
Basic Installations - Installing a new sump pump or replacing an existing unit generally costs between $250 and $600. Local contractors often perform these projects efficiently within this range, depending on the system’s complexity and accessibility.
Full System Replacement - Replacing an entire sump pump system, including basin and backup options, can range from $1,000 to $3,000. Larger or more complex setups, especially in homes with difficult access, may push costs higher but are less common.
Advanced or Custom Projects - Custom sump pump solutions or extensive drainage system upgrades can cost $3,500 or more. These projects are typically tailored to specific needs and represent a smaller portion of the total work done by local service providers.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are signs that a sump pump may need repairs? Common indicators include frequent cycling, strange noises, or if the pump fails to activate during heavy rain, suggesting that a local contractor should evaluate the system.
How does a sump pump help prevent basement flooding? A sump pump removes excess water from the basement area, reducing the risk of flooding and water damage, which local service providers can help install or maintain.
What maintenance tasks are recommended for sump pumps? Regularly inspecting and cleaning the pump and pit, testing the float switch, and ensuring the power source is reliable are tasks that local contractors can assist with.
Can a sump pump be installed in an existing basement? Yes, experienced local service providers can install a sump pump in existing basement setups to improve water management and prevent flooding issues.
What types of sump pumps are available for different needs? There are pedestal and submersible sump pumps, each suited for specific situations, and local pros can help determine which type fits a particular basement’s requirements.
